  • Abstract
    The University of Huddersfield in collaboration with AWE is running a number of research programmes with the aim of creating a high-level interface (HLI) between the codec algorithms and parameters for the Reed-Solomon (RS) code, and a generic hardware circuit description. In VHDL these HDL models can then be submitted to a silicon compiler to give a complete path from algorithm to silicon. The paper outlines the work completed to-date with the emphasis on the use of VHDL within the project
